EquiLead’s Events Diary

August was a busy month for the team at EquiLead.

  • Our co-leads Anchal and Aiswarya attended a national dissemination event Advancing Women in Health Leadership: Barriers and Breakthroughs organised by the International Center for Research on Women (ICRW) - Asia. In this event, ICRW - Asia presented key findings and explored strategies to empower women to achieve equitable career progression and leadership roles in the health workforce in India. You can watch the recording here.
  • On August 5, the CII Centre for Women Leadership in collaboration with the US State Department organised an interaction with Ms. Mercedes Soria, Executive Vice President of Software Engineering and the Chief Intelligence Officer at Knightscope Inc. Anchal and Aiswarya were invited for this conversation that brought together industry leaders from across sectors to uncover the current development in the field of AI and Machine learning while exploring the opportunities for inclusion of women through the evolution of this sector.
  • Our Gender Expert Meghana Rao was invited as an evaluator for final assignment for E4 Social Impact Leadership Program by VOICE 4 Girls sponsored by Australian Aid. VOICE 4 Girls’ leadership program is primarily designed for young people seeking for opportunities and pathways to continue their journey in social impact. As a part of their final assignment and a mandatory project to graduate from the program, the participants have to create a Personal Action Plan for themselves, mapping their future journeys and the project they plan to work on.
  • Anchal and Aiswarya were invited to attend Journey Towards Viksit Bharat: A Post Union Budget 2024-25 Conference at Vigyan Bhawan, New Delhi on July 30. The conference captured key reform measures for the next few years, including those outlined in the Union Budget 2024, and collectively charted a path for Viksit Bharat. Prime Minister Narendra Modi delivered the inaugural address.

Women and the Workplace

The horrific incidents reported last month have refocused attention on women's safety and the critical need for institutional infrastructure to ensure their well-being. Despite laws like the POSH Act, women in sectors from corporate to education and entertainment still face denial of their basic right to safety.

We spoke to Prena G Chatterjee, POSH Consultant and Advisor, Priya Vardarajan, Founder and Chief Imagination Officer, Durga and Pallavi Sobti-Rajpal, Joint CEO, Utthan on what safety at the workplace entails and the various measures organisations can take to make it a priority going beyond the POSH Act.

Women's workforce participation in India Inc stands at 19%, according to The Udaiti Foundation's analysis of 2,100 NSE-listed companies.
